CommonInstaller: migrate from custom DroidGuard to Official

merge-requests/23/head
Christopher Roy Bratusek 5 years ago
parent 49867b1c64
commit f2fc575e62

@ -329,21 +329,22 @@ detect_mode () {
}
detect_migrate_microg () {
GMSCORE_PATH=$(find /data/app -type d -name 'com.google.android.gms*' 2>/dev/null)
GMSCORE_NANOLX=0
GMSCORE_PATH=$(find /data/app -type d -name 'com.google.android.gms-*' 2>/dev/null)
if [ ! -z ${GMSCORE_PATH} ]; then
if ${UNZIP} -l "${GMSCORE_PATH}/base.apk" | grep META-INF/NANOLX.RSA 2>/dev/null; then
echo " + NanoDroid microG GmsCore installed in /data/app"
GMSCORE_NANOLX=1
echo " + Removing NanoDroid microG GmsCore in favor of Official microG GmsCore"
rm -rf "${GMSCORE_PATH}"
fi
else
GMSCORE_NANOLX=0
fi
if [[ "${GMSCORE_NANOLX}" -eq 1 ]]; then
echo " + Removing NanoDroid microG GmsCore in favor of Official microG GmsCore"
rm -rf "${GMSCORE_PATH}"
DROIDGUARD_PATH=$(find /data/app -type d -name 'org.microg.gms.droidguard-*' 2>/dev/null)
if [ ! -z ${DROIDGUARD_PATH} ]; then
if ${UNZIP} -l "${DROIDGUARD_PATH}/base.apk" | grep META-INF/NANOLX.RSA 2>/dev/null; then
echo " + Removing NanoDroid DroidGuard in favor of Official DroidGuard"
rm -rf "${DROIDGUARD_PATH}"
fi
fi
}
@ -1484,8 +1485,6 @@ NANODROID_UPGRADE=${NANODROID_UPGRADE}
NANODROID_BINDIR=${NANODROID_BINDIR}
HAS_FAKESIGN=${HAS_FAKESIGN}
HAS_WEBVIEW=${HAS_WEBVIEW}
GMSCORE_PATH=${GMSCORE_PATH}
GMSCORE_NANOLX=${GMSCORE_NANOLX}
### MOUNTED PARTITIONS ###
" >> ${nanodroid_logfile}

Loading…
Cancel
Save